S.C.I.A.C.E. - Super Kinetogenic Idiorhythmic Automated Combat Electronics

An arcade dogfighter where you play as a SCIACE drone fighting back against an evil oppressor's mobile fortress. Made for LD39 and inspired by the scale of games like Shadow of the Colossus the MEOWStudios team bring you their newest prototype game!

The Objective of the game is to destroy the mother ship in the center of the desert by first destroying its shield generator, then its comms tower, then various vitals on the outside of the ship and finally its fusion core. Be careful not to run out of power while doing so however as this will mean the end of our cause!

(Playtime - 5-10 minutes)

Controls - - Mouse controls to Yaw and Pitch - W and S to use Throttle - A and D to Roll - Left Click to Shoot - Shift to Lock Rotation - Space to Look Around

Background music is Jessica Day's Methodology licensed under creative commons.

Note: It's not obvious, but enemies drop items that will refuel your ship.
